Important Physics Topics for JEE Main Session 2

Physics questions in JEE Main usually test conceptual clarity along with formula-based problem solving. Students appearing in Session 2 should revise key chapters that often carry multiple questions.

Topics to revise in Physics:

  • Modern Physics

  • Current Electricity

  • Rotational Motion

  • Work, Energy, and Power

  • Ray Optics

  • Thermodynamics

These chapters often include direct formula-based questions as well as conceptual problems. Practicing numerical questions from these topics can be helpful before the exam.

Chemistry Topics to Focus for Session 2

Chemistry is considered one of the scoring sections in JEE Main when students revise core concepts properly. Many questions are based on standard theory and reactions from textbooks.

Important Chemistry chapters:

  • Chemical Bonding

  • Coordination Compounds

  • Mole Concept

  • Chemical Kinetics

  • General Organic Chemistry (GOC)

  • Biomolecules

Students appearing in Session 2 should revise important reactions, formulas, and concepts from these chapters carefully.

Mathematics Topics for JEE Main Session 2

Mathematics questions in JEE Main can be time-consuming, so focusing on frequently asked chapters can help students manage the exam better.

Key Maths topics to revise:

  • Matrices and Determinants

  • Limits and Continuity

  • Differential Equations

  • Quadratic Equations

  • Sequences and Series

  • Vector and 3D Geometry

Practicing problems from these chapters can help students improve both speed and accuracy.

Section B Strategy for JEE Main 2026 Session 2

In JEE Main 2026, Section B contains numerical-type questions where students need to enter the exact value as the answer. These questions require careful calculation.

Helpful tips for Section B:

  • Read the question carefully

  • Double-check calculations before submitting

  • Avoid guessing the answer

  • Attempt questions where you are confident

Since numerical questions require accuracy, students should practice similar questions during their revision.
